The Mauro Molino Barolo DOCG 2020 "Cuvée Conca" is a distinguished wine from the revered Piedmont region in Italy. It is crafted exclusively from Nebbiolo grapes, the quintessential variety known for producing some of Italy's most prestigious red wines. The 2020 vintage has proven to be promising, offering a remarkable balance of tannins and acidity. The terroir of Barolo comprises mainly calcareous clay soils, contributing to the wine's distinct structure and complexity. The vinification process for this esteemed Barolo includes extended maceration and aging in large oak casks, enhancing its depth and ensuring it matures gracefully over time.
The Piedmont region is famed for its diverse landscape and continental climate, which are instrumental in developing Nebbiolo's unique characteristics. The combination of hot summers and cold winters, along with the region's rich historical heritage in winemaking, solidifies its status as a significant viticultural area. The complex soil compositions, typical of Barolo’s hilly terrains, impart a remarkable minerality and nuanced flavour profile to the wines produced here.
For a wine of such elegance and power, pairing it with robust dishes that can complement its intensity is essential. Traditional Piedmontese fare, such as osso buco or brasato al Barolo (beef braised in Barolo wine), are perfect companions. Additionally, the wine's high acidity and firm tannins make it suitable for rich, meaty dishes like roasted lamb or game meats. For vegetarians, a creamy risotto with truffles or mushrooms would enhance the wine’s earthy flavours.
To fully appreciate the complexity and elegance of the Mauro Molino Barolo DOCG 2020, serve it at a temperature between 16-18°C. Decanting the wine for an hour prior to serving will also help in unveiling its rich bouquet and nuanced palate, making for an exquisite tasting experience.
